Ticket: Greenhouse bay 4 humidity readings from the Ferngate controller have drifted roughly 6% over two weeks. Root cause is not the sensors — staging calibration values were deployed to production because calibrate.env was copied wholesale during last month's migration. The drift-correction service has been silently rejecting calibration uploads since then, as it was authenticating against the staging broker. To restore uploads, correct the broker hostname in calibrate.env and then add the production broker credential directly beneath it:

secret setting of kagug-kajop: LEDGER_TOKEN3=342

## Authentication

Heads up: the nightly reindex job (`reindex_nightly.py`) talks to the Lanternfish search cluster, and that cluster won't accept anonymous writes anymore — we locked it down last sprint. The job now authenticates as the `reindex-runner` service identity against Corvid Gateway, and the token is injected via the `LF_INDEX_TOKEN` env var in the scheduler config. Nothing clever going on, just a bearer header on every batch request. For review purposes, the staging credential currently in use is listed below.

service key, kadug-kadup: kto15_rN23XLAYImmZgrJ

## Onboarding: Farebranch Rules Engine

Plugin authors integrate with Farebranch by registering fee rules against the evaluation API. Rules are sandboxed; they cannot perform network calls directly. All rate-table lookups go through the host, which validates your plugin manifest at load time. Your local env file must include the signing credential the host uses to verify manifests, set on the next line.

secret setting of bajef-fajof: COURIER_KEY3=76c